Aflion Cloudy Shadow vs. Jwick Taro

An in-depth look at the Aflion Cloudy Shadow and the Jwick Taro switches—which one is the best fit for you?

Overview

The aflion cloudy shadow and the jwick taro are two unique mechanical keyboard switches that offer distinct typing experiences. The cloudy shadow, a linear switch, is best known for its neutral sound signature and bouncy feel thanks to the extended springs, providing a balanced typing experience with a 63.5g bottom-out force. On the other hand, the taro, a tactile switch, offers a cozy typing experience with a snappy, medium level of tactility and crisp clacks. The cloudy shadow is categorized as [low-pitched, mild, neutral], while the taro is categorized as [neutral, buttery, stepped]. Both switches have their own set of advantages, making them appealing options for different preferences. Housing materials

The Aflion Cloudy Shadow and the Jwick Taro both utilize polycarbonate for their top housing, resulting in a sharper, higher-pitched, and crisper sound profile. This material is known for being relatively stiff, which contributes to a clear and resonant sound when typing. Additionally, the translucent nature of polycarbonate makes it ideal for switches that incorporate RGB lighting. On the other hand, both keyboards feature a bottom housing made of nylon, which produces a deeper and fuller sound profile. Nylon is softer compared to polycarbonate, absorbing more sound and creating a duller, rounder sound when typing.

Travel distance

The Aflion Cloudy Shadow linear switch has a travel distance of 3.5 mm, while the Jwick Taro tactile switch has a slightly longer travel distance of 3.7 mm. Both switches fall within the range of shorter travel distances, which are becoming more popular, especially among gamers looking for faster response times. Those who prefer a more responsive feel may lean towards the Cloudy Shadow, with its slightly shorter travel distance. On the other hand, individuals who enjoy a deeper keypress may find the Taro more to their liking due to its longer travel distance. Typing experience

In terms of sound, both the Aflion Cloudy Shadow and the Jwick Taro switches are described as having a neutral sound profile. The Cloudy Shadow offers a low-pitched sound with a more bass-heavy and mellow tone, while the Taro provides a moderate sound profile that is suitable for various purposes. It is important to note that the sound of a switch can also be influenced by other factors such as the keyboard and keycaps being used.

When it comes to feel, the Aflion Cloudy Shadow is described as having a mild typing experience, offering a gentle feel that is approachable to most users. On the other hand, the Jwick Taro switches are said to have a buttery sensation, implying a smooth and fluid keystroke experience, along with a stepped tactile feedback that provides a mild sensation with some pre-travel and/or post-travel feeling.
